Description

If you're looking for a straightforward, accessible jog in the Mill Creek East area, the Running loop from Mill Creek East is a solid choice. This moderate 3.4-mile (5.6 km) route offers a gentle 106 feet (32 metres) of elevation gain, making it perfect for a quick 35-minute workout or a relaxed run, especially if you're new to the Mill Creek East jogging trails.

What to expect on Running loop from Mill Creek East

Expect a generally smooth experience on this multi-use path, often paved, as it winds alongside Mill Creek. You'll enjoy views of the creek itself, with sections passing through light forests and open meadows, offering a pleasant backdrop for your run. The gentle grades mean you won't face any strenuous climbs, making it ideal for those seeking a consistent pace without significant challenge. It's a great option for a casual jog or a recovery run.

Planning your visit

Access to the Running loop from Mill Creek East is generally straightforward, with parking often available near the trailhead, though specific details can vary. Many trails in this region are multi-use and accessible, often featuring amenities like restrooms and water fountains. This route is suitable for year-round use, but check local conditions during winter for any potential ice or snow.

Trail details

  • Distance: 3.4 miles (5.6 km)
  • Elevation gain: 106 feet (32 metres)
  • Difficulty: moderate
  • Estimated time: 35 minutes
